Page Nav






From Zero to Profit: The Ultimate Guide to Building a Profitable Blog from Scratch!

  Welcome to "From Zero to Profit: The Ultimate Guide to Building a Profitable Blog from Scratch! " In this comprehensive guide, w...


Building a Profitable Blog from Scratch!

Welcome to "From Zero to Profit: The Ultimate Guide to Building a Profitable Blog from Scratch!" In this comprehensive guide, we'll unlock the secrets to turning your passion for blogging into a lucrative venture. 

Discover how a successful blog opens doors to financial freedom, global reach, and industry recognition. Brace yourself for an actionable journey, as we provide step-by-step strategies, practical tips, and expert insights to help you navigate the path to blogging success. 

Get ready to unleash your creativity, captivate your audience, and embark on a rewarding adventure that can change your life forever. Let's dive in and build your profitable blog from the ground up!

Table of Content

What is Blog and Blogging

Defining Your Niche and Target Audience

Setting Up Your Blog

Crafting Quality Content

SEO and Blog Traffic Strategies

Building an Engaged Community

Monetization Methods

Analyzing and Improving Blog Performance

Overcoming Challenges and Staying Motivated


Final Thought

What is Blog and Blogging

A blog is a digital platform where individuals or businesses regularly publish content, such as articles, images, and videos, to share their insights, expertise, or personal experiences with an online audience.

Blogging refers to the act of creating and managing a blog. It enables writers to connect with readers, foster discussions through comments, and build a community around shared interest. 

Blogging covers a wide range of topics, from travel and lifestyle to technology and business. It serves as a powerful tool for self-expression, education, and communication, providing valuable information and entertainment to readers worldwide.


Defining Your Niche and Target Audience


Understanding the importance of niche selection


A niche refers to a specific segment or topic within a broader industry or subject area. Selecting the right niche is crucial for a successful blog because it allows you to focus your content on a particular area of interest. Here's why niche selection is vital:

Audience Appeal: A well-defined niche attracts a targeted audience who share a common interest, leading to higher engagement and a dedicated readership.

Authority Building: By consistently delivering valuable content in a specific niche, you establish yourself as an expert, building authority and credibility within your chosen field.

Differentiation: In a competitive blogging landscape, a niche sets you apart from others and helps your blog stand out.


Identifying your passions and expertise


When choosing a niche, it's essential to align it with your passions and expertise. Here's how to identify your true passions and areas of expertise:

Self-Reflection: Take time to reflect on what topics genuinely excite and inspire you. Consider your hobbies, interests, and the subjects you naturally gravitate towards.

Knowledge and Skills: Assess your expertise in various fields, whether acquired through education, work, or personal experiences.

Intersection: Look for the intersection of your passions and expertise. The sweet spot is where your knowledge aligns with your interests, making it easier to create compelling and authoritative content.


Conducting market research to define your target audience


Market research helps you understand your target audience better, allowing you to tailor your content to their preferences and needs. Follow these steps for effective market research:

Define Your Audience: Create audience personas, which are fictional representations of your ideal readers. Consider demographics, interests, pain points, and goals.

Analyze Competitors: Study successful blogs in your niche to understand their content strategies and the needs they fulfill for their audience.

Engage Your Audience: Interact with potential readers through surveys, social media, and comments to gather insights and feedback.

Keyword Research: Utilize keyword research tools to identify popular topics and search terms related to your niche, helping you align your content with what your target audience is searching for.

By understanding the importance of niche selection, identifying your passions and expertise, and conducting thorough market research, you can create a blog that resonates with your audience and sets the foundation for a profitable venture.


Setting Up Your Blog


Choosing the right blogging platform (e.g., WordPress, Blogger, etc.)


Assessing Platform Options: Explore various blogging platforms available, such as WordPress, Blogger, Squarespace, and others. Compare their features, ease of use, and customization options.

WordPress Advantages: Highlight the popularity and flexibility of WordPress, which offers extensive themes, plugins, and customization opportunities.

Blogger Benefits: Discuss the simplicity and integration with Google services that make Blogger a suitable choice for beginners.

Self-Hosted vs. Hosted: Explain the difference between self-hosted and hosted platforms and their implications on control, ownership, and scalability.


Selecting a domain name that reflects your niche and brand

Importance of Domain Name: Emphasize how a domain name represents your blog's identity and is essential for branding and memorability.

Relevant and Descriptive: Suggest choosing a domain name that reflects your niche or the main theme of your blog, making it easier for readers to understand what your blog is about.

Short and Memorable: Advise opting for a concise and easy-to-remember domain name to increase brand recall and user engagement.

Avoiding Copyright Issues: Caution against using trademarked names or existing brand names to prevent legal complications.


Setting up hosting and installing necessary plugins


Web Hosting Selection: Guide readers on choosing a reliable web hosting provider that offers suitable packages, performance, and customer support.

Installing WordPress: For self-hosted blogs, provide step-by-step instructions on installing WordPress on the chosen hosting platform.

Essential Plugins: Recommend essential plugins for security, SEO, analytics, and performance optimization.

Customization: Encourage readers to explore themes and customize their blog's appearance to align with their brand and niche.

By providing guidance on choosing the right blogging platform, selecting a suitable domain name, and handling the technical aspects of hosting and plugins, readers can confidently set up their blog and focus on creating valuable content for their audience.


Crafting Quality Content


Emphasizing the significance of high-quality content for a successful blog


Content as the Foundation: Stress the importance of quality content as the backbone of a successful blog.

Building Trust and Authority: Explain how valuable content helps build trust with the audience and establishes you as an industry authority.

Engaging Readers: Discuss how well-crafted content keeps readers coming back for more, increasing user engagement and loyalty.

SEO Benefits: Highlight how search engines favor high-quality content, leading to better rankings and increased organic traffic.

Developing a content strategy and editorial calendar

Setting Goals: Encourage defining clear objectives for the blog, such as increasing traffic, generating leads, or promoting products/services.

Knowing Your Audience: Stress the need to understand the target audience's preferences, pain points, and interests to tailor content accordingly.

Content Topics: Guide readers in brainstorming relevant and engaging topics that align with their niche and audience's needs.

Creating an Editorial Calendar: Advise on organizing content creation and publishing schedule to maintain consistency and meet objectives.

Utilizing various content formats (blog posts, videos, infographics, etc.)


Diversification: Explain the value of using different content formats to cater to various audience preferences.

Blog Posts: Highlight the significance of well-structured blog posts that provide valuable insights, solutions, or entertainment.

Videos: Showcase the power of video content for engaging audiences and conveying complex information in an accessible way.

Infographics: Illustrate how infographics can simplify complex data and statistics, making information more shareable and visually appealing.

Podcasts: Discuss the growing popularity of podcasts and how they offer an opportunity to reach audiences on-the-go.

By understanding the importance of high-quality content, developing a strategic content plan, and incorporating diverse content formats, bloggers can effectively connect with their audience, grow their readership, and achieve long-term success.


SEO and Blog Traffic Strategies


Understanding the basics of Search Engine Optimization (SEO)


SEO Defined: Explain what SEO is and its role in improving a blog's visibility on search engines like Google.

Organic Traffic: Highlight how SEO drives organic traffic, attracting visitors who are genuinely interested in the content.

Keywords and Rankings: Introduce the concept of keywords and how they influence search engine rankings.

User Experience: Emphasize that SEO is not just about search engines but also enhancing user experience.

Implementing on-page SEO techniques (keyword research, meta tags, etc.)


Keyword Research: Guide readers on conducting keyword research to identify relevant and high-traffic keywords for their niche.

On-Page Optimization: Explain the importance of incorporating keywords naturally into titles, headings, and content.

Meta Tags: Introduce meta titles and meta descriptions and their role in improving click-through rates from search engine results.

Image SEO: Discuss optimizing images with descriptive alt tags and file names for better search engine visibility.

Off-page SEO strategies (link building, guest posting, social media promotion)


Link Building: Explain the significance of acquiring high-quality backlinks from reputable websites to boost blog authority.

Guest Posting: Discuss the benefits of guest posting on other blogs to reach new audiences and build relationships within the industry.

Social Media Promotion: Showcase how leveraging social media platforms can drive traffic, engagement, and increase blog visibility.

Influencer Marketing: Introduce the concept of collaborating with influencers to expand reach and credibility.

By grasping the basics of SEO, implementing on-page optimization techniques, and employing off-page strategies, bloggers can enhance their blog's visibility, attract targeted traffic, and gain a competitive edge in their niche.


Building an Engaged Community


Encouraging and responding to comments on your blog


Creating a Welcoming Environment: Emphasize the importance of fostering a positive and inclusive atmosphere for readers to feel comfortable engaging.

Responding Promptly: Advise bloggers to actively respond to comments, showing appreciation for feedback and answering questions.

Encouraging Discussion: Prompt readers with thought-provoking questions to encourage more comments and interactions.

Acknowledging Contributions: Recognize and highlight valuable insights shared by readers in the comments section.

Leveraging social media platforms to connect with your audience


Social Media Presence: Explain the significance of having an active presence on relevant social media platforms.

Consistent Branding: Encourage bloggers to maintain consistent branding across their social media profiles to reinforce their blog's identity.

Engaging Content: Suggest creating engaging content tailored to each platform to encourage interactions, shares, and followers.

Responding to Messages: Stress the importance of responding to direct messages and comments on social media to build relationships with the audience.

Hosting webinars, live Q&A sessions, or other interactive events


Interactive Experiences: Highlight the value of hosting live events that allow real-time interaction with the audience.

Webinars: Explain how webinars provide an opportunity to share valuable insights, demonstrate expertise, and engage with participants.

Live Q&A Sessions: Discuss the benefits of hosting live Q&A sessions to address audience questions and concerns directly.

Virtual Workshops or Events: Introduce the idea of organizing virtual workshops or events to offer in-depth learning experiences and foster a sense of community among participants.

By encouraging active engagement with comments, leveraging social media platforms, and hosting interactive events, bloggers can cultivate a thriving community around their blog. An engaged community not only enhances the blog's reputation but also creates a loyal audience that is more likely to share content and contribute to the blog's growth.


Monetization Methods


Exploring different ways to monetize your blog (e.g., affiliate marketing, ads, products)


Affiliate Marketing: Introduce the concept of affiliate marketing, where bloggers promote products or services and earn commissions on sales generated through their unique affiliate links.

Display Ads: Discuss the option of displaying ads on the blog through platforms like Google AdSense or working with ad networks to generate income based on ad impressions and clicks.

Sponsored Posts: Explain how bloggers can collaborate with brands to create sponsored content, receiving compensation for promoting products or services within their niche.

Digital Products: Mention that bloggers can create and sell their digital products, such as e-books, templates, printables, or software, to their audience.

Creating and promoting digital products (eBooks, online courses, etc.)


E-books: Discuss the process of creating and formatting e-books as a valuable resource for readers and a potential source of passive income.

Online Courses: Explain how bloggers can package their expertise into online courses, providing in-depth learning experiences for their audience and generating revenue.

Membership Sites: Introduce the idea of creating exclusive content or a community and offering it through a membership-based model.

Partnering with brands and sponsored content opportunities


Collaborating with Brands: Offer tips on approaching and building relationships with brands relevant to the blog's niche.

Sponsored Content: Explain how bloggers can negotiate sponsored content opportunities that align with their audience's interests and maintain authenticity.

Sponsored Social Media Posts: Discuss the possibility of partnering with brands for sponsored social media posts or campaigns to increase monetization opportunities.

By exploring diverse monetization methods, creating and promoting digital products, and seizing sponsored content opportunities, bloggers can diversify their income streams and turn their passion into a profitable venture. It's essential to strike a balance between monetization and providing valuable content to maintain the trust and loyalty of their audience.


Analyzing and Improving Blog Performance


Monitoring blog analytics to track progress


Utilizing Analytics Tools: Introduce popular analytics platforms like Google Analytics to track essential metrics such as traffic, pageviews, bounce rates, and user behavior.

Setting Goals: Advise bloggers to define specific goals, such as increasing pageviews, conversions, or engagement, to measure their blog's performance effectively.

Regular Analysis: Stress the importance of regular analysis to identify trends, patterns, and areas that need improvement.

Key Performance Indicators (KPIs): Discuss various KPIs that bloggers can focus on based on their blog's objectives.

Identifying areas for improvement and optimization

Content Performance: Guide bloggers on analyzing the performance of individual blog posts, identifying high-performing and low-performing content.

User Experience: Discuss the significance of optimizing the blog's layout, navigation, and mobile responsiveness to enhance user experience.

SEO Audit: Encourage bloggers to conduct periodic SEO audits to identify areas for improvement in keyword targeting, meta tags, and overall search engine visibility.

Conversion Optimization: Advise on optimizing calls-to-action, landing pages, and lead capture forms to improve conversion rates.

Staying updated with blogging trends and adapting strategies accordingly

Following Industry Leaders: Encourage bloggers to follow influential figures and blogs in the industry to stay updated on the latest trends and best practices.

Subscribing to Newsletters: Recommend subscribing to newsletters and industry publications to receive updates and insights directly in their inbox.

Experimenting with New Tactics: Suggest being open to trying new blogging strategies, content formats, or promotional techniques to keep the blog fresh and engaging.

A/B Testing: Introduce the concept of A/B testing to experiment with different elements and determine what resonates best with the audience.

By monitoring blog analytics, identifying areas for improvement, and staying updated with industry trends, bloggers can continuously enhance their blog's performance, attract more readers, and adapt to the ever-changing blogging landscape. An iterative and data-driven approach is essential for sustained growth and success.


Overcoming Challenges and Staying Motivated


Addressing common challenges faced by bloggers


Content Burnout: Offer strategies for dealing with content burnout, such as taking breaks, seeking inspiration from other sources, and involving guest writers.

Lack of Traffic: Provide guidance on improving blog visibility through SEO, social media promotion, and networking with other bloggers.

Time Management: Share time management tips to help bloggers balance blogging with other responsibilities and commitments.

Comparison and Self-Doubt: Address the issue of comparing oneself to other successful bloggers and offer advice on staying focused on personal growth and progress.

Tips for overcoming writer's block and staying consistent


Create an Editorial Calendar: Encourage bloggers to plan content in advance, which reduces the pressure of coming up with ideas on the spot.

Freewriting: Suggest the practice of freewriting as a way to overcome writer's block and generate new ideas.

Set Realistic Goals: Advise on setting achievable writing goals to maintain consistency without overwhelming oneself.

Find Inspiration: Encourage bloggers to find inspiration from diverse sources like books, movies, nature, or personal experiences.

Keeping the motivation alive during the journey to profitability


Remind of Initial Goals: Encourage bloggers to revisit their initial reasons for starting the blog and remember their long-term vision.

Celebrate Milestones: Acknowledge the importance of celebrating small wins and milestones along the way.

Engage with Readers: Remind bloggers that engaging with their audience and receiving positive feedback can be a great source of motivation.

Join Blogging Communities: Suggest joining blogging communities or forums where bloggers can connect, share experiences, and support each other.

Overcoming challenges and staying motivated is crucial in the journey to profitability. By addressing common blogging challenges, finding ways to combat writer's block, and maintaining a strong sense of motivation, bloggers can stay focused, persistent, and committed to achieving their blogging goals.


What is the purpose of a blog?

The purpose of a blog is to provide a platform for individuals or businesses to regularly publish content and share their insights, expertise, or personal experiences with an online audience. Blogs serve various purposes, including self-expression, education, marketing, and building a community around shared interest.

How do I start a blog?

To start a blog, choose a niche or topic you are passionate about, select a blogging platform (e.g., WordPress, Blogger), register a domain name, and set up web hosting. Create valuable and engaging content, promote your blog through social media, SEO, and networking, and interact with your audience through comments and feedback.

Can I make money from blogging?

Yes, blogging can be monetized through various methods, such as affiliate marketing, displaying ads, selling digital products (eBooks, online courses), sponsored content, and partnerships with brands. However, building a profitable blog requires consistent effort, quality content, and a growing readership.

How often should I publish new content on my blog?

The frequency of publishing new content depends on your goals, niche, and available time. Consistency is essential, whether it's publishing weekly, bi-weekly, or monthly. Focus on providing valuable content rather than overwhelming readers with frequent posts.

How can I attract more readers to my blog?

To attract more readers, focus on SEO to improve search engine visibility, promote your blog through social media, collaborate with other bloggers, and engage with your audience through comments and social interactions. Providing valuable and shareable content will also help in increasing readership.

What are some common challenges bloggers face, and how can they overcome them?

Common challenges for bloggers include content burnout, lack of traffic, time management, and self-doubt. Bloggers can overcome these challenges by taking breaks, seeking inspiration, optimizing content for SEO, setting realistic goals, and finding a support network within the blogging community.

How can I measure my blog's performance and success?

You can measure your blog's performance through various metrics like website traffic, pageviews, bounce rate, time on site, and conversion rates. Use analytics tools like Google Analytics to track these metrics regularly and set specific goals to gauge your blog's success.

How can I engage with my blog audience?

Engage with your audience by responding to comments, asking questions in your posts to prompt discussions, and using social media to interact with readers. Hosting webinars, live Q&A sessions, and creating interactive content also foster engagement and community-building.

Can I start a blog as a business or personal hobby?

Yes, you can start a blog for either business or personal reasons. Many individuals start blogs as a hobby to share their interests and experiences, while others create blogs as a business to promote products, services, or generate income through various monetization methods.

What topics can I blog about?

You can blog about virtually any topic that interests you or aligns with your expertise. Popular blog niches include travel, food, lifestyle, technology, personal finance, health, fashion, and many more. Choose a niche that you are passionate about and can consistently create valuable content for.

Final Thought

Building a Profitable Blog from Scratch! Throughout this guide, we've covered the key steps to create a successful blog. From defining your niche and audience to setting up the blog, crafting quality content, and implementing SEO strategies, we've provided valuable insights. 

Monetization methods, engaging the community, and staying motivated were also explored. Now, it's time to take action! Start your blogging journey today, use the knowledge gained, and unlock the potential benefits—financial freedom, industry authority, and global reach. 

Embrace the transformative power of a successful blog, connect with readers worldwide, and make your mark in the dynamic world of blogging.

No comments